& Hybrid warning message
SHSAB03
A message is automatically displayed
when a malfunction occurs in the hybrid
system or an improper operation is at-
tempted.
If a warning message is shown on the
combination meter display (color LCD),
read the message and follow the instruc-
tions.
NOTE
If a warning light comes on, a warning
message is displayed or the 12 V
battery is disconnected, the hybrid
system may not start. In that case, try
to start the system again. If the Hybrid
READY indicator light does not come
on, contact your SUBARU dealer.
HS-3. Hybrid vehicle driving
tips
SHSAC
WARNING
. Always start the hybrid system
while sitting in the drivers seat.
Do not depress the accelerator
pedal while starting the hybrid
system under any circum-
stances. Doing so may cause an
accident resulting in death or
serious injury.
. When restarting the hybrid sys-
tem after an emergency shut-
down while driving, press the
ignition switch. When restarting
the hybrid system after stopping
the vehicle, change the select
lever position to “P” and then
press the ignition switch.
For economical and ecological driving, pay
attention to the following points.
. Use of power meter
Eco-friendly driving is possible by keeping
the power meter within the Eco area. Refer
to “Power meter” FP177.
. Select lever position operation
Shift the select lever position to the “D”
position when stopped at a traffic light, or
when driving in heavy traffic.
Shift the select lever position to the “P”
position when parking.
Selecting the “N” position has no positive
effect on fuel consumption. In the “N”
position, the gasoline engine operates
but electricity cannot be generated. Also,
when using the climate control system,
etc., the high voltage battery power is
consumed.
. Accelerator pedal/brake pedal op-
eration
Drive your vehicle smoothly. Avoid
abrupt acceleration and deceleration.
Gradual acceleration and deceleration
will make more effective use of the
electric motor (traction motor) without
having to use gasoline engine power.
Avoid repeated acceleration. Re-
peated acceleration consumes high
voltage battery power, resulting in poor
fuel consumption. Battery power can
be restored by driving with the accel-
erator pedal slightly released.
Make sure to operate the brakes
gently and in a timely manner when
braking. A greater amount of electrical
energy can be regenerated when
slowing down.
